一种虚拟身份证生成的方法与系统与流程

文档序号:14250050阅读:24141来源:国知局
一种虚拟身份证生成的方法与系统与流程

本发明涉及一种虚拟身份信息代替真实身份的生成方法与系统,尤其涉及一种公安系统个人身份信息的虚拟身份身份生成方法与系统。



背景技术:

随着社会不断进步和人们生活圈的不断扩大,信息安全问题已经成为困扰人们日常生活的一个重大社会问题,往往因为在办理某些业务需要提供个人身份证或者是联系方式等原因导致个人数据信息被意外泄露,由此引发后续生活过程中各种因个人信息泄露而带来的困然甚至是损失。

目前已经采取了很多措施来保护个人隐私信息,也取得了很好的效果,但是仍有许多不足,其中比较显著的的是个人身份证号码信息,由于明码方式暴露出来,及其容易被不法分子人利用与非法用途,只是该人蒙受损失或受到威胁。



技术实现要素:

针对目前身份证号码使用时存在的潜在风险,本发明提出一种虚拟身份证生成的方法与系统,通过合法采集设备采集用户的身份证号信息,组成虚拟身份证申请请求发送到公安内网系统,由公安内网系统对设备及用户身份进行核对后创建并维护一个与之对应的虚拟身份证,合法采集设备为该虚拟身份证号创建对应二维码公布给用户使用,从而避免了身份证号码直接暴露出来,有效保护了用户的个人隐私,同时将虚拟身份信息做成二维码的方式不经给使用带了很大的便利,同时更进一步的避免了号码直接被识别出来,进一步提高了安全性。本发明解决其技术问题所采用的技术方案包括以下步骤:

采集身份数据步骤,通过采集设备采集用户的身份证号信息,并将该信息组织成特定命令请求生成虚拟身份证号。

优选的,采集数据要求用户输入身份证号且确认是本人操作、提供的是合法身份证号,非法身份证号码被直接拒绝且终止虚拟身份证创建活动。

优选的,所述确认是本人操作可以是本人持身份证现场确认,也可是其他无人化自动确认方式。

核对信息步骤,公安内网收系统到申请虚拟身份证号码请求后对发送请求的设备合法性和用户身份信息有效性进行核对。

优选的,若检测出采集设备为经过公安内网系统备案的非法设备时,终止虚拟身份证的生成动作且返回非法设备告警,若检测出用户身份证号码为无效身份证号,则终止虚拟身份证生成活动并返回无效身份证号告警信息。

创建虚拟身份证步骤,公安内网系统根据用户身份证号采用创建一个与之对应的虚拟身份证号。

优选的,公安内网系统采用特定算法来根据用户真实身份证号创建虚拟身份证号,且同时创建它们的映射关系写进公安内网数据库。

优选的,所述映射关系为用户采用虚拟身份证进行身份认证时提供数据索引以找到用户的真实身份证号。

公布虚拟身份证步骤,数据采集设备根据公安内网系统发送的用户虚拟身份证号信息。

优选的,采集设备接收到公安内网系统公布的虚拟身份证信息后为该信息创建二维码公布给用户为其使用带来安全和便利。

采用上述技术方案,本发明具有以下优点:

本发明涉及一种虚拟身份证生成的方法与系统,通过合法采集设备采集用户的身份证号信息,组成虚拟身份证申请请求发送到公安内网系统,由公安内网系统对设备及用户身份进行核对后创建并维护一个与之对应的虚拟身份证,合法采集设备为该虚拟身份证号创建对应二维码公布给用户使用,从而避免了身份证号码直接暴露出来,有效保护了用户的个人隐私,同时将虚拟身份信息做成二维码的方式不经给使用带了很大的便利,同时更进一步的避免了号码直接被识别出来,进一步提高了安全性。

附图说明

图1为本发明较佳实施方式的一种虚拟身份证生成的方法与系统的步骤示意图。

图2为本发明较佳实施方式的一种虚拟身份证生成的方法与系统的系统模块图。

图3为本发明较佳实施方式的一种虚拟身份证生成的方法与系统的详细流程图。

具体实施方式

下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整的描述,显然,所描述的实施例仅仅是本发明的一个实施例,而不是全部实施例。基于本发明中的实施例,本领域的一般技术人员在没有做出创造性劳动的前提下所获得的其他实施例,都属于本发明保护的范围。

本发明实施例公开了一种虚拟身份证生成的方法,参见图1所示,该方法包括:

步骤s1:通过采集设备采集用户的身份证号信息,并将该信息组织成特定命令请求生成虚拟身份证号。

步骤s2:公安内网收系统到申请虚拟身份证号码请求后对发送请求的设备合法性和用户身份信息有效性进行核对。

步骤s3:公安内网系统根据用户身份证号采用创建一个与之对应的虚拟身份证号。

步骤s4:数据采集设备根据公安内网系统发送的用户虚拟身份证号信息。

本发明实施例中,通过合法采集设备采集用户的身份证号信息,组成虚拟身份证申请请求发送到公安内网系统,由公安内网系统对设备及用户身份进行核对后创建并维护一个与之对应的虚拟身份证,合法采集设备为该虚拟身份证号创建对应二维码公布给用户使用。

可见,采用虚拟身份证号的方式彻底避免了身份证号码直接暴露出来,有效保护了用户的个人隐私,同时将虚拟身份信息做成二维码的方式不经给使用带了很大的便利,同时更进一步的避免了号码直接被识别出来,进一步提高了安全性。

本发明实施例公开了一种虚拟身份证生成的系统,参见图2所示,该系统包括以下模块:

采集终端模块m1:用于采集用户身份证号码并返回虚拟身份证创建结果和虚拟身份证信息。

优选的,所述终端对用户输入的身份证号码进行合法性检测并对非法身份证号码返回警告且终止创建虚拟身份证活动,同时该终端还为虚拟身份证号创建二维码公布给用户。

公安内网系统模块m2:用于核对请求合法性并查询数据库创建管理用户身份证对应的虚拟身份证信息。

优选的,所述终端对采集设备的合法性、用户身份信息的真实性进行校验,在校验失败是终止虚拟身份证创建活动且发出失败告警,在检验成功后为用户创建并维护虚拟身份证号码返回给采集设备。

本发明实施例公开了一种虚拟身份证生成的方法与系统,参见图3,相对以上两个实施例,本实施例对技术方案作了进一步的说明和优化。具体包括以下步骤:

s11:采集用户身份信息步骤。

优选的,采集终端m1采集用户身份证号码信息,并核对是否是本人操作。

s12:核对身份证号合法性步骤。

优选的,采集终端m1对采集到的身份证号码进行合法性校验,对于非法身份证号码执行步骤中s13,对于合法身份证号码执行步骤中s21。

s21:核对设备合法性步骤。

优选的,采集终端m1将创建虚拟身份证请求发送给公安内网系统模块m2后,公安内网系统模块m2对设备的合法性进行检测,若检测出该设备并未在公安内网系统模块中备案,则执行步骤s13,否则执行步骤s22。

s22:核对用户身份信息步骤。

优选的,公安内网系统模块m2对合法设备发送的申请虚拟身份证号进行用户信息核对,若提交申请的用户信息在公安内网系统模块m2中存记录且与用户提供的匹配,则执行步骤s31,否则执行步骤s13。

s31:创建虚拟身份证信息步骤。

优选的,对于通过身份核对的用户提出的虚拟身份认证请求,公安内网系统模块m2采用特定算法为之创建虚拟身份证号,接着执行步骤中s32。

s32:创建虚拟身份与真实身份信息的映射关系步骤。

优选的,公安内网系统将用户的真实身份信息与创建的虚拟身份证信息建立以一对一的映射关系,用于用户采用虚拟身份证进行身份认证时提供查询以获取用户的真实身份信息,在执行完该步骤后接着执行步骤中s4。

s4:生成虚拟身份证二维码信息步骤。

优选的,公安内网系统模块m2将虚拟身份证信息发送给采集终端m1后,m1将用户的虚拟身份证号生成对应的二维码信息后发送给用户使用,然后执行步骤s13。

s13:结果反馈步骤。

优选的,根据处理步骤和结果的不同,有采集设备m1向用户显示申请虚拟身份证的处理结果,申请成功的情况下显示虚拟身份证二维码,失败的情况提示失败原因。

综上所述,采集终端m1执行步骤s11采集用户身份证号码并确认是本人操作后执行步骤中s12,对用户提供的身份证号码进行合法性校验,若检验失败则执行步骤s13通知用户申请虚拟身份证由于非法身份证号而失败,若步骤s12校验成功,则m1将该请求发送给公安内网系统模块m2执行步骤s21,对采集终端的合法性进行校验,若发现该终端未曾在公安内网系统模块备案,则执行步骤s13通知用户申请虚拟身份证由于非法采集终端而失败,若步骤s21检验成功则执行步骤s22,根据用户提供的身份证号在公安内网系统m2查询对应的身份记录并做核对,若核对结果为未通过则执行步骤s13通知用户申请虚拟身份证由于用户身份证校验不通过而失败,若步骤s22检验通过,则执行步骤s23位用户创建虚拟身份证号码,并建立该虚拟身份证与真实身份证一一对应的映射关系,然后执行步骤s4,通知采集终端m1虚拟身份证号并由采集终端m1为该虚拟身份证号创建对应的二维码,最后执行步骤s13,向用户通知创建虚拟身份证号成功并公布虚拟身份证二维码。采用虚拟身份证号的方式彻底避免了身份证号码直接暴露出来,有效保护了用户的个人隐私,同时将虚拟身份信息做成二维码的方式不经给使用带了很大的便利,同时更进一步的避免了号码直接被识别出来,进一步提高了安全性。

以上所述仅为举例性,而非为限制性。本领域的技术人员可以对发明进行各种改动和变型而不脱离本发明的精神和范围。这样,倘若本发明的这些修改和变型属于本发明权利要求及其等同技术的范围之内,则本发明也意图包括这些改动和变型在内。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1